Ejemplo n.º 1
0
def test_z3mage():
    """ Test z~3 MagE
    """
    # All
    z3mage = LLSSurvey.load_mage_z3()
    assert z3mage.nsys == 60
    assert len(z3mage.sightlines) == 105
    # Non-Color
    z3mage_NC = LLSSurvey.load_mage_z3(sample='non-color')
    assert z3mage_NC.nsys == 32
    assert len(z3mage_NC.sightlines) == 61
Ejemplo n.º 2
0
def test_z3mage():
    """ Test z~3 MagE
    """
    # All
    z3mage = LLSSurvey.load_mage_z3()
    assert z3mage.nsys == 60
    assert len(z3mage.sightlines) == 105
    # Non-Color
    z3mage_NC = LLSSurvey.load_mage_z3(sample='non-color')
    assert z3mage_NC.nsys == 32
    assert len(z3mage_NC.sightlines) == 61
Ejemplo n.º 3
0
def test_z3mage():
    """ Test z~3 MagE
    """
    # All
    z3mage = LLSSurvey.load_mage_z3()
    assert z3mage.nsys == 60
    assert len(z3mage.sightlines) == 105
    # Non-Color
    z3mage_NC = LLSSurvey.load_mage_z3(sample='non-color')
    assert z3mage_NC.nsys == 27
    assert len(z3mage_NC.sightlines) == 61
    # Stats
    lz, sig_lz_low, sig_lz_up = z3mage_NC.binned_loz([2.6, 3.],
                                                     NHI_mnx=(17.49, 23.))
    assert np.isclose(lz[0], 1.20521669)
Ejemplo n.º 4
0
def test_gz():
    # All
    z3mage = LLSSurvey.load_mage_z3()
    zeval, gz = z3mage.calculate_gz()
    assert gz[4000] == 67
    np.testing.assert_allclose(zeval[4000], 2.8705998897560931)
Ejemplo n.º 5
0
def test_gz():
    # All
    z3mage = LLSSurvey.load_mage_z3()
    zeval, gz = z3mage.calculate_gz()
    assert gz[4000] == 67
    np.testing.assert_allclose(zeval[4000], 2.8705998897560931)